This Amendment No. 4 (this “Amendment”) to Schedule 14D-9 amends and supplements the Schedule 14D-9 previously filed by Overseas Shipholding Group,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Company”), with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(the “SEC”) on June 10, 2024 (as amended or supplemented from time to time, the “Schedule 14D-9”), with respect to the cash tender offer made by Seahawk MergeCo., Inc., a Delaware corporation (“Purchaser”) and wholly owned subsidiary of Saltchuk Resources, Inc., a Washington corporation (“Parent”), to purchase all of the Company’s issued and outstanding shares of Class A common stock, par value $0.01 per share (the “Shares”), pursuant to the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of May 19, 2024, by and among Parent, Purchaser and the Company (as it may be amended from time to time, the “Merger Agreement”), at a purchase price of $8.50 per Share, without interest and subject to any applicable withholding taxes (such consideration as it may be amended from time to time pursuant to the terms of the Merger Agreement), upon the terms and subject to the conditions set forth in the Offer to Purchase, dated June 10, 2024 (together with any amendments or supplements thereto, the “Offer to Purchase”), and in the related Letter of Transmittal (together with any amendments or supplements thereto, the “Letter of Transmittal,” which, together with the Offer to Purchase and other related materials, constitutes the “Offer”). The Offer is described in a Tender Offer Statement on Schedule TO (as amended or supplemented from time to time), filed by Parent and Purchaser with the SEC on June 10, 2024. The Offer to Purchase and the Letter of Transmittal have been filed as Exhibits (a)(1)(i) and (a)(1)(ii) to the Schedule 14D-9, respectively, as each may be amended or supplemented from time to time.

Expiration of the Offer; Completion of the Merger

 

The Offer and withdrawal rights expired one minute past 11:59 p.m. Eastern Time on July 9, 2024. Based on the final information provided by the Depositary and Paying Agent on July 10, 2024, 47,770,076 Shares were validly tendered in the Offer and not validly withdrawn, representing approximately 66% of all outstanding Shares. As a result, the Minimum Condition has been satisfied. As the Minimum Condition and each of the other Offer Conditions have been satisfied, Purchaser has accepted for payment all Shares that were validly tendered and not validly withdrawn pursuant to the Offer.

 

Pursuant to a Certificate of Merger filed with the Secretary of State of the State of Delaware on July 10, 2024, Purchaser was merged with and into OSG through a merger under Section 251(h) of the DGCL, with OSG surviving the Merger and continuing as a wholly-owned subsidiary of Parent. In the Merger, each Share not acquired in the Offer and iss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time (other than Shares held by any stockholders who properly demand appraisal in connection with the Merger) was converted into the right to receive the Offer Price, without interest, less any applicable withholding taxes, except for Shares then owned by Parent, Purchaser, OSG or any of their respective wholly-owned subsidiaries, which Shares were cancelled at the Effective Time without any consideration delivered in exchange therefor. All Shares converted into the right to receive the Offer Price ceased to be outstanding and were automatically cancelled and ceased to exist. Following the Merger, the common stock of OSG was delisted and ceased to be traded on the NYSE.
